М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
mashuna1
mashuna1
19.05.2020 17:44 •  Информатика

6.нужно написать программу в с++. определить класс «студент». сведения о студенте состоят из его фамилии, оценок по сессии, номера курса и кода группы, в которой он учится. предусмотреть возможность вывода фамилий и номеров групп для студентов, имеющих оценки 4 и 5; обеспечить вывод информации о студентах группы, код которой вводится с клавиатуры. если таких студентов нет, вывести соответствующее сообщение. (максимальная оценка «хорошо»).

👇
Открыть все ответы
Ответ:
Danielllllllll
Danielllllllll
19.05.2020

Сначала производится инициализация массива, в конце - выводится на печать n.

Содержательная часть программы - эта:

n := ves[1];

For i := 1 to 14 Do

  If Ves[i] < n Then

  Begin

     n : = ves[1]

  End;

Здесь сначала n равно ves[1], затем в цикле, если ves[i] меньше n, то n  присваивается равным ves[1]. Если бы было присвоение ves[i], то получился бы алгоритм поиска минимального элемента (ответ был бы 21 = min[25, 21, 23, 28, 30, 25, 31, 28, 25, 28, 30, 27, 26, 24]). Но здесь вне зависимости от значений всегда присваивается n = ves[1], поэтому в n в любой момент времени записан первый вес (25), он и будет выведен на экран.

ответ: 25

4,6(35 оценок)
Ответ:
Katteerina25
Katteerina25
19.05.2020
Var
  i: Integer;       //  рабочая переменная для for
  k: Integer;       //  количество минимальных элементов
  n: Integer;       //  размер массива  m : array [1..10] of Integer; // Собственно сам массив  из "n" элементов
  i_min : Integer;  // Индекс минимального элемента в массиве
begin
  n:=10;  k := 0;  i_min := 1;
  for i := 1 to n  do
  begin
    m[i] := Random(10);  // 10 - Число от балды
    if (m[i]<m[i_min]) then
    begin
      k := 1;
      i_min := i
    end
    else
      if (m[i]=m[i_min]) then
        inc(k);
  end;

  // В переменной "k" - находится количество минимальных элементов
end;
4,5(23 оценок)
Это интересно:
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